密码学与网络安全 - 5 有限域 & 6 高级加密标准

本文深入探讨了有限域的数学概念,包括群、环、域和多项式运算,重点介绍了有限域GF(2^n)及其在高级加密标准AES中的应用。AES的结构和变换函数,如字节替代、行移位、列混淆和轮密钥加,以及密钥扩展算法的原理和雪崩效应,都被详细阐述。
摘要由CSDN通过智能技术生成

5 有限域

许多加密算法都依赖于有限域的性质,特别是高级加密标准和椭圆曲线加密算法,还包括消息认证码CMAC以及认证加密方案GMC

5.1 群

群、环和域都是数学理论中的一个分支

5.1.1 群

群记做G,定义二元运算 · ,对于任何一对有序偶(a,b),满足:

  1. 封闭性
  2. 结合律
  3. 单位元
  4. 逆元

根据元素个数有限和无限分为有限群和无限群

5.1.2 交换群

  1. 满足交换律

5.1.3 循环群

如果群中每一个元素都是一个固定元素a的幂a^k(k为整数),则称群G为循环群

5.2 环

环 R

满足1-5

  1. 乘法封闭性
  2. 乘法结合律
  3. 分配律
  4. 乘法交换律:交换环
  5. 乘法单位元:存在元素1,a1= 1a = a 成立
  6. 无零因子:存在元素a,b,且ab=0,则必有 a=0或b=0

5.3 域

记作 F

满足以上 + 乘法逆元

5.4 有限域

无限域在密码学中没有什么特别的意义,但是两个有限域比较重要

有限域的阶(元素的

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值